The IT Security: Defense against the Digital Dark Arts course introduces learners to the fundamental principles of information security. It focuses on the concepts, tools, and best practices required to defend systems and networks against a wide range of cyber threats.

From cryptography and authentication to network security and attack detection, this course equips you with practical knowledge to understand vulnerabilities and implement strong defense strategies. It is ideal for anyone looking to start a career in cybersecurity or enhance their technical knowledge of digital security.
